Jakarta, ThedailydID – ERHA Skincare Group has reinforced its position as a leader in Indonesia’s dermatological skincare market with the launch of three clinically driven product innovations. Announced during a media gathering in Jakarta on February 15, 2026, the company introduced ERHA SKINSITIVE Ultracalm Face Sunscreen, ERHA ACNEACT Micellar Water, and HisErha Duo Premium Perfume as part of its strategy to strengthen its dermatology-focused portfolio.
The launch comes amid rapid growth in Southeast Asia’s dermatological skincare market. The sector was valued at US$1.52 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ach US$2.29 billion by 2030, reflecting an average annual growth rate of 8.54%. Indonesia plays a central role in this expansion, accounting for roughly 43.5% of the region’s sensitive skincare market.
Domestically, Indonesia’s overall skincare industry is expected to grow to US$4.64 billion by 2032. Against this backdrop, ERHA reaffirmed its commitment as an Indonesian dermatological skincare brand that has consistently delivered clinic-based skin solutions for more than 25 years.
